AMD Ryzen AI 9 365 makes Geekbench debut with heavy throttling

AMD's 10-core Ryzen AI 9 365 CPU has just made its Geekbench debut. It performs on par with its 12-core sibling (Ryzen AI 9 HX 370). However, there is a lot of scope for improvement because the chip was not operating at its peak.

Despite Strix Point slated to be "AMD's largest laptop launch ever", it has only shown off two SKUs so far. The top-spec Ryzen AI 9 HX 370 was nothing short of stellar, trading blows with the Ryzen 9 7950X in Cinebench 2024's single-core test. The other model (Ryzen AI 9 365) has now shown up on Geekbench.

It scores 2,730 and 13,032 points in Geekbench 6.2's single and multi-core tests. The Ryzen AI 9 365 sample in question was powering an Acer Swift laptop with 16 GB of RAM. It boosts up to 4.4 GHz, much lower than AMD's advertised boost clock of 5.0 GHz. A cursory glance at its clocks reveals heavy throttling, presumably due to pre-production hardware/software.

The Ryzen AI 9 365's single-core performance is more or less on par with the Ryzen AI 9 HX 370, not surprising given both use the same Zen 5 CPU cores. Multi-core performance is more or less the same. According to our benchmark database, the last-gen Ryzen 9 8945HS scored 2,684 and 13,238 points in Geekbench 6.2, making it slightly slower than the Strix Point SKU. On the other hand, the Meteor Lake-based Core Ultra 9 185H lagged behind in single-core performance with 2,492 points, but leveled the playing field in multi-core (13,972).

For now, the Intel Core i9-14900HX reigns supreme in Geekbench 6.2 single-core performance metrics. However, it could be dethroned once the Ryzen AI 9 HX 370 and Ryzen AI 9 365 hit their full potential in retail units. Plus, Lunar Lake is not scheduled to arrive until next year and when it does, it isn't topping any benchmark charts, at least ones that involve raw performance.
